WebDoctors must complete four years of undergraduate education, followed by four years of medical school and 3-7 years of residency, depending on their specialization. Nurse practitioners complete four years of undergraduate study, generally work for several years, then complete 2-4 years of additional schooling for their DNP degrees. WebFeb 20, 2013 · The first year (or more) students complete the RN portion of their degree. The second (and possibly third) year of the program students are prepared as nurse practitioners. This means that upon graduating you have an RN degree but will be immediately eligible for employment as a nurse practitioner. WebNurse practitioner school length for a DNP degree after earning your BSN will take between 3 to 4 years full-time or 4 to 7 years part-time.
